The Southwest Florida Chapter of the Florida Public Relations Association presents PR University 2009: "Weathering the Storm." a one-day seminar for public relations professionals, from 8 a.m. to 4:30 p.m. Friday, Jan. 9, at Hodges University in Fort Myers. Public relations professionals from throughout Florida will share their insights and innovations about crisis management, surviving tough economic times and fool-proofing your career in a series of dynamic, fast-paced presentations. Attendees will also hear from a lively keynote speaker and participate in a crisis-related tabletop exercise. To register or find more information, visit www.fpraswfl.org.

The Institute for Responsible Corporate Governance at the Lutgert College of Business at Florida Gulf Coast University presents "Seismic Changes in the Washington Landscape and Their Effect on Corporate Governance" from 3 to 5 p.m. Thursday, Jan. 15, at FGCU's Sugden Welcome Center. Guest speaker will be John Castellani, president of The Business Roundtable and frequent guest on "The NewsHour with Jim Lehrer" and "Meet the Press." Cost is $25. Practicing psychotherapists, mental health counselors, social workers and marriage and family therapists are invited to "Core Tasks of Psychotherapy," a workshop presented by the Department of Counseling and Psychological Services at Florida Gulf Coast University from 9 a.m to 4 p.m. Saturday, Jan. 17, at the FGCU Student Union. Clinician and researcher Donald Meichenbaum will discuss the Constructive Narrative Cognitive Behavior approach to changing behavior. Cost is $120 for professionals and $50 for graduate students.
